Calling All Artists!

The Groton Senior Center is seeking artists to turn ordinary chairs into art for a fundraising auction. Chairs have been donated and are available on a first come, first serve basis at the Groton Senior Center (102 Newtown Road). Artists may come in and sign out a chair, bring it home and use their imagination to restyle, decorate, refinish, or transform the chair however they would like.

Chairs must be returned to the Senior Center before January 10th. Chairs will then be displayed in community businesses to promote the auction and the artists and the auction will be held Friday, April 4th. Proceeds from the auction will benefit the Senior Center's community programs and services.
